The Adjustment Brush inside of Camera Raw is probably one of the biggest features to hit raw editing since the raw image itself. In this video, Matt goes over the key features of the tool, how to use it, and how you can take advantage of the non-destructive power of raw editing with a brush.

Whether it's caused by lack of sleep, too much work, stress, skin texture and tone or whatever, lots of people have dark circles under their eyes. Since removing them requires just a tiny bit of brush work, they make a perfect candidate for a quick Photoshop retouch.

Adobe added Camera Profiles to Camera Raw that automatically do a great job at making your photo look better. When coupled with a feature that lets you set default settings in the raw dialog, you've got a great combination that will end up saving you a lot of time and giving your photos a much better starting place.
